DAYTONA BEACH, Fla. (AP) - All-Pro receiver Randy Moss is now a
NASCAR team owner, announcing Thursday he's purchased 50 percent of
a Truck Series team.
Randy Moss Motorsports will make its debut on July 19 at
Kentucky Speedway with Willie Allen driving the No. 81 Chevrolet.
The number was changed from 46 to reflect Moss' NFL jersey number.
Moss has been eyeing entering NASCAR for some time, but said he
decided to buy half of Morgan-Dollar Motorsports rather than build
a team from the ground up. Moss wants the team to eventually move
up to the premier Sprint Cup Series.
